I feel older generations have this notion that technology is ruining the world. In some aspects, yes, but in others, no. Technology has played a massive role in developing new medical equipment and medications. It has also increased life expectancy and reduced child mortality. Another big thing it has helped is finding cures to diseases people would have never thought would be cureable.Cons:
Technology has also made our lives a lot easier. Technology has allowed us to send messages anywhere in the world in seconds. It has also allowed us to become more connected than ever and be able to meet new people all over the world. Another thing that has allowed us to do is get news instantly. Before this, you had to wait for the evening news to broadcast the latest story or the newspaper to come the next morning. Lastly, technology has made our lives a lot easier by finding information. Nowadays, if you don’t know the answer to a question, you go straight to Google and look up the answer.

Now, as good as all of that sounds, technology has downfalls. I believe technology is ruining the way we communicate with each other. Many people are glued to their phones and only text people. I feel that it hurts society as a whole because people will soon be unable to talk to others. This will cause huge mental health concerns because people are not going to be able to talk about their feelings or be able to sustain relationships. On the topic of mental health, cyberbullying is at an all-time high. Many people are being bullied on social media with pictures or posts about other people.
